Intenza ZL-10 Leg Press | Three Resistance Profiles in a Single Machine
The Intenza ZL Leg Press offers unmatched versatility with distinct resistance profiles to suit any training goal. Load the top horns for a descending profile – heaviest at the bottom – to build strength in the strongest range. Use the bottom horns for an ascending profile – lightest at the start, heaviest at lockout – to overcome sticking points and work around injuries by avoiding weak or painful ranges.
